Vertical Garden Ideas
1. Pallet Vertical Garden
Repurpose old wooden pallets by transforming them into vertical planters. Attach small pots or planters to the slats of the pallet and fill them with your favorite plants or herbs. Hang the pallet vertically on a wall or lean it against a sturdy surface for a rustic and space-saving garden.
2. Succulent Wall Art
Create a living work of art by arranging a variety of colorful succulents in a vertical planter. Choose a mix of shapes, sizes, and textures to create a visually appealing display. Succulents are low-maintenance plants that thrive in vertical gardens, making them perfect for beginners.
Hanging Gardens
1. Macrame Plant Hangers
Add a bohemian touch to your space with macrame plant hangers. These intricate hangers are perfect for suspending your favorite plants from the ceiling or hooks. Mix and match different designs and lengths to create a cascading garden effect.
2. Hanging Terrariums
Bring a touch of whimsy to your indoor spaces with hanging terrariums. Fill glass orbs or geometric containers with small plants, moss, and decorative stones to create mini ecosystems that dangle beautifully from the ceiling. Hang them at varying heights for added visual interest.
